Bug Description

If I turn the wifi off and then want to turn it on again it doesn't work from the indicator.
I need to open Network Settings and turn it on from there.

Maccer (maccer) wrote :

I have the "Wireless" toggle but it doesn't turn on if I click on it. Also the toggle is more white than the toggle of other indicators,as if I'm not allowed to switch it.
However I can turn it off if I was using wifi previously.

My wifi works perfect, is just that toggle.

Martin (uzivatelmp) wrote :

I've made modified deb package, where I bypassed the hardware_locked check. Now it works. Maybe you should add some setting to ignore the hardware lock state if the machine is reporting it incorrectly.
